| Description: | From Sixty Short Pieces for Pipe or Reed Organ.
This piece is one of the few more substantial pieces in the book. They are described as being a collection of easy pieces - they can be played on manuals or with pedals.
The piece calls for a Quintadena. This was solved by using hauptwerk's master coupler to the Positif and using the octave on the 16' Quintaton with the 8' stops on the Positif.
Flor Peeters (1903 - 1986) was a Belgian organist, composer and teacher. To read more about him visit http://www.bach-cantatas.com/Lib/Peeters-Flor.htm.
Played on the rear ranks.
